Transaction 05136673631eabc78b2bf5e630612e56454ed068514830c9e96d45e83394d3d6
1 Input
2 Outputs
- 05136673631eabc78b2bf5e630612e56454ed068514830c9e96d45e83394d3d6:0
- 05136673631eabc78b2bf5e630612e56454ed068514830c9e96d45e83394d3d6:1
value 70695
address 1CBPmcg9m4EnXW9uHTDZMoLu8vLaJwnKZM
value 475124
address 1Q65AUzzshAHt7ChfTXE1BkDTRwCTodaHC